Archos 5 constantly rebooting after reset. I keep seeing the welcome screen, "Archos, entertainment your way". I have booted it in the safe mode by holding down the volume + button after powering it on. Selected repair disk, format disk, but it continues to do the same thing. Also, tried the hard reset using a paper clip. Again the same thing. The device has been upgraded to the latest firmware just a couple of weeks ago.

Why does my dell inspiron 1501 freeze on the welcome screen?

Hi,

Try to go to Safe Mode by reseting the computer then tapping F8. If your able to acces safe mode follow these instructions:

1. Go to start then click on RUN
2. Type msconfig
3. go to services tab, click hide microsoft services then click disable all
4. reboot the computer and see it it will go to normal mode. It you will be able to boot to normal mode it only means that one of the isntalled software is preventing windows to load
5. if still cant boot you neet to reformat the system

Stuck on the ARCHOS Screen and it won't do any thing

A) Download the firmware from Archos and save it to your desktop (Make sure the file name on the desktop hasn't changed from the original download file name)

B) The Archos 705:
1- Connect the unit to its power source.
2- Start the unit in recovery mode: Press the TV button first then the power on/off and keep pressing TV button (do not release it)
3- The recovery mode will start (the screen that asks for repair or format etc…)
4- Select "Repair" by scrolling up and down with the TV Button (it is all explained to move through the menu at the top of the Archos screen) (Do not press "Format" at any time)
5- Now that you are on "Repair" select it to validate your selection
6- The unit will go to "Plug the unit etc…" plug it with the USB cable to the computer
8- Wait until Pc should recognizes your Archos (around 5 seconds)

C) Computer
1- From your computer select the firmware file you downloaded from the net and put it in your Archos (in the root folder, nowhere else, where it has the folders, music, videos, pictures etc… as a file)

D) On the Archos 705:
1- Select "Ok" on the Archos (on & off button) shortly to select and confirm the file is now on the Archos
2- you are done! The Archos 5 or 7 should now read through the file you have transferred and repair the system
3- DO NOT DISCONNECT the power cable until the process is finished
4- When done safely disconnect (as you usually do, for Mac trash the letter of the Archos to the bin or for PC's: right click the green icon bottom right of the screen for xp & vista)
5- Press on/off button to reboot

Your unit should restart with a fresh repaired, updated system like day one.

Archos 5 frozen screen

I have found a solution for this issue, if you hold down the volume button and the power button for several seconds the Archos goes into a restore type mode. You then plug it into your computer and download the latest firmware update and cut and paste it onto the archos removable hard drive icon that appears in my computer. It will take a few minutes to update but then it will work perfectly.
